India Expresses Concern Over Red Sea Security, Monitors Developments Amid Rising Houthi Attacks

Brief by Shorts91 Newsdesk / 03:57pm on 18 Jan 2024,Thursday India

India voices apprehension regarding the security situation in the Red Sea, emphasizing the importance of freedom of navigation and commerce in the region. External Affairs Ministry spokesperson Randhir Jaiswal labels the escalating attacks by Yemen's Houthis in the Red Sea and Gulf of Aden as a "matter of concern." The recent drone attack on a merchant vessel in the Gulf of Aden led to the evacuation of all 21 crew members by India's INS Visakhapatnam. Houthi rebels' support for Hamas and targeting commercial ships intensifies global worries, altering maritime routes. The US and UK respond with airstrikes, impacting crucial shipping lanes.
